For a manual, yes. From what I remember you'd need custom mounts etc, You can do a m52b28 swap bolt straight in with the right parts. Only custom work is the wiring adapter (easily find a wiring diagram) and the exhaust. Then spend what you have left on the motor like OBD1 swap or suspension, cert etc...
